WebAug 13, 2016 · The best way to maintain your flag is to take it down and repair at the first sign of fraying or tears. Begin by trimming the frayed ends, and then sew a new hem that resembles the original hem. Make sure that you use a heavy duty thread that matches the colors in the flag. WebYes, you can iron a nylon flag, but you must take extra care to ensure that it does not get damaged. When ironing a nylon flag, make sure to keep the heat setting on low and to use a pressing cloth. Pressing cloths made from durable fabrics such as cotton or linen are recommended as they help distribute the heat evenly while protecting the flag ...
